Notlar Title from colophon (f. 158v, 349v)., Foliation: Coptic numeral foliation, upper left recto; catchwords every verso, lower left. Foliation in Arabic numerals added in pencil, upper left recto. References in the record are to the Arabic foliation., Layout: Written in 22 long lines., Script: Written in naskh in black ink; pointed, vocalized., Decoration: Headpieces in red, yellow and black with occasional green (f. 1r, 43r, 76r, 100r, 131v, 159r, 180r, 200r, 203r, 230v, 252v, 277v, 301r, 323r); rubrications in red; some small ornaments in red., Binding: Bound in brown leather over pasteboard with flap (Type II); faint blind stamped central mandorla on covers with inlay mandorla on flap; plain paper doublure., Origin: Copy completed on 14 Baūnah in 1476 of the Coptic Calender (June 1760 CE) for Yaʻqūb ibn Ibrāhīm, in Asyūṭ (f. 349v)., Watermarks: Three crescent moons; anchor., Owner's notations on the flyleaves and next to every colophon. | Arabic. | Formerly owned by Ibrāhīm ibn Yūsuf al-Rashīdī (numerous notations and signatures, see f. 42v, 99v, for example)., Formerly owned by the Dropsie College for Hebrew and Cognate Learning (library bookplate inside front cover).
Örnek Metin Copy of the Pentateuch and Historical Books (Joshua, Judges, Ruth, Samuel, Kings and Chronicles).
